Вопросы с тегом «http»

Все о программах и сервисах, использующих протокол передачи гипертекста.

121
HTTP-сервер простой командной строки

У меня есть сценарий, который генерирует ежедневный отчет, который я хочу предоставить так называемой широкой публике. Проблема в том, что я не хочу добавлять к своей головной боли обслуживание HTTP-сервера (например, Apache) со всеми настройками и последствиями для безопасности. Существует ли...

48
Могу ли я создать переопределение DNS, аналогично записи в / etc / hosts без прав root

Я хочу установить запись DNS, которую будет использовать мой браузер, но у меня нет доступа с правами root, поэтому я не могу изменить /etc/hosts. Мне нужно сделать это для тестирования vhosts с apache, DNS которого еще не настроен. У меня есть доступ к Firefox и Chrome, так что, если есть плагин,...

33
Изменить Apache httpd «Сервер:» HTTP заголовок

Один из заголовков HTTP, который Apachehttpd отправляет обратно с ответными данными, - «Сервер». Например, мой компьютер с веб-сервером является относительно современным Arch Linux. Он отправляет обратно заголовки, похожие на следующие: HTTP/1.1 404 Not Found Date: Thu, 10 Apr 2014 17:19:27 GMT...

30
Скачать большой файл через плохое соединение

Существует ли существующий инструмент, который можно использовать для загрузки больших файлов через плохое соединение? Я должен регулярно загружать относительно небольшой файл: 300 МБ, но медленное (80-120 КБайт / с) TCP-соединение случайно разрывается через 10-120 секунд. (Это сеть большой...

29
Как я могу воспроизвести музыкальный поток HTTP через SSH?

Я знаю , что я могу делать , mplayer <stream>чтобы открыть и играть поток на локальном компьютере. Тем не менее, я за брандмауэром. Вместо этого я хотел бы открыть поток на удаленной машине , но по-прежнему воспроизводить его на этом . Для удаленных подключений используется SSH , но...

24
Общий HTTP-сервер, который просто сбрасывает POST-запросы?

Я ищу инструмент командной строки, который прослушивает заданную часть, с радостью исключает каждый запрос HTTP POST и выводит его. Я хочу использовать его для тестирования, то есть для тестирования клиентов, которые выдают запросы HTTP POST. Это означает , что я ищу коллегу к curl -F(который я...

24
Как проверить, выполнена ли такая команда, как curl, без ошибок?

Я использую curl для загрузки файла на сервер через сообщение HTTP. curl -X POST -d@myfile.txt server-URL Когда я вручную выполняю эту команду в командной строке, я получаю ответ от сервера, как "Upload successful". Однако как, если я хочу выполнить эту команду curl через скрипт, как я могу узнать,...

23
Какой инструмент можно использовать для прослушивания трафика HTTP / HTTPS?

Я ищу инструмент командной строки, который может перехватывать запросы HTTP / HTTPS, извлекать такую ​​информацию, как: (содержимое, место назначения и т. Д.), Выполнять различные задачи анализа и, наконец, определить, следует ли отбросить запрос. Юридические запросы должны быть направлены в...

18
Не удается получить доступ к избранным сайтам https в Linux через PPPoE

Раньше мое интернет-соединение было прямым соединением с моим провайдером. Тогда все работало бы нормально как в Windows, так и в Ubuntu (двойная загрузка). Однако некоторое время назад они начали нуждаться в том, чтобы я набирал номер (PPPoE), используя имя пользователя и пароль. Шлюз, маска...

16
Как я могу Telnet к порту HTTP 80?

После поиска в Google я обнаружил, что мы можем telnetподключиться к веб-серверу на его http-порт и использовать его GETдля извлечения html-страницы. Например: $ telnet web-server-name 80 Но я не могу понять, как это возможно? Я думал, что если порт 80 для http-сервера, то порт 80 будет только...

14
Синхронизация с каталогом веб-сервера

Есть ли простой способ синхронизировать папку с каталогом через HTTP? Редактировать : Спасибо за совет с Wget! Я создал скрипт оболочки и добавил его в качестве задания cron: remote_dirs=( "http://example.com/" "…") # Add your remote HTTP directories here local_dirs=( "~/examplecom" "…") for (( i =...

12
Wget возвращает двоичный файл вместо HTML?

Я использую wget для загрузки статической HTML-страницы. W3C Validator сообщает, что страница закодирована в UTF-8. Тем не менее, когда я загружаю файл после загрузки, я получаю кучу глупостей. Я нахожусь на Ubuntu, и я думал, что кодировка по умолчанию была UTF-8? Вот что говорит мой файл локали....

10
Как я могу использовать файлы из HTTP в качестве предварительных условий в GNU make?

Я хочу использовать файлы из World Wide Web в качестве предварительных условий в моих make-файлах: local.dat: http://example.org/example.gz curl -s $< | gzip -d | transmogrify >$@ Я хочу «преобразовать», только если удаленный файл новее, чем локальный файл, как обычно работает make . Я не...

9
Есть ли в командной строке универсальный HTTP-прокси (например, Squid)?

Я могу легко использовать Netcat (или Socat) для захвата трафика между моим браузером и конкретным хостом: портом. Но для Linux существует ли какой-либо аналог командной строки Squid-подобного HTTP-прокси, который я могу использовать для захвата трафика между моим HTTP-клиентом (браузером или...

9
Смонтировать HTTP-сервер как файловую систему

У меня есть машина, на которой я хочу смонтировать несколько удаленных серверов для централизованного доступа к ним. Для удаленных систем на базе Linux я использую SSHFS, которая работает нормально. Но для систем Windows или систем без SSH все они имеют установленный HTTP-сервер для обмена файлами...

8
Есть ли какие-нибудь хорошие инструменты, кроме SeleniumRC, которые могут извлекать веб-страницы, включая контент, написанный после JavaScript?

Одним из основных недостатков curlявляется то, что все больше и больше веб-страниц окрашивают свой основной контент в ответ JavaScript AJAX, который происходит после первоначального ответа HTTP. curlникогда не узнает об этом пост-окрашенном контенте. Поэтому, чтобы получить эти типы веб-страниц из...